タグ

ysomtokのブックマーク (2,099)

  • VimのUniteプラグインでファイル、バッファ、ブックマーク管理

    VimのUniteプラグインで、ファイル、バッファ、レジスタ、ブックマークを管理する方法を紹介します。 この記事を読んで、できるようになること vim上でディレクトリを移動し、ファイルを開くことができる。最近使用したファイル一覧から、ファイルを開くことができる。現在開いているバッファを一覧表示し、バッファを開いたり、削除することができる。レジスタの情報を一覧から選択し、貼り付けることができる。ファイルやフォルダをお気に入り登録し、お気に入りから目的のファイルを開くことができる。 目次 環境 uniteとは uniteのインストール vimrcの設定 uniteの操作方法 現在開いているファイルのディレクトリ下のファイル一覧を表示 最近使用したファイル一覧を表示 バッファ一覧を表示 レジスタ一覧を表示 ブックマーク一覧を表示 環境 検証した環境は下記の通りですが、MacLinuxでも同じ設

    VimのUniteプラグインでファイル、バッファ、ブックマーク管理
    ysomtok
    ysomtok 2014/04/29
    uniteの初期設定に使った。
  • キーマップ設定の○map。どのモードで有効か。noremapって何。 - memo@hilott

    nmapやらvmapやらはどんなとき有効になるマップなのかまとめ表ノーマルビジュアル 演算待ち 挿入 コマンド map ○ ○ ○ map! ○ ○ nmap ○ vmap ○ omap ○ imap ○ cmap ○ 頭が"n"ならノーマルモードで有効になり、尻に"!"をつけると指定したモード以外で有効になるのですね。 noremapってなんだろう下記の設定でキー{B}を押すと、Aが実行されて、さらにマップされている{X}が実行されます。 map {A} {X} map {B} {A} 下記のようにこの{B}をnoremapに変えると map {A} {X} noremap {B} {A} {B}を押すと{A}は実行されますが、1行目の設定までは展開せず、{X}は実行されません。なので下記のようにnoremapでなくmapしてしまうとllllll....となるのです。 :map l ll

    ysomtok
    ysomtok 2014/04/29
    mapの有効範囲。
  • 「OAuth」の基本動作を知る

    デジタル・アイデンティティの世界へようこそ はじめまして、OpenID Foundation JapanでエバンジェリストをしているNovです。 この連載では、僕を含めOpenID Foundation Japanにかかわるメンバーで、OpenID ConnectやOAuthなどの「デジタル・アイデンティティ(Digital Identity)」にかかわる技術について紹介していきます。 APIエコノミー時代のデジタル・アイデンティティ 世界中で9億人のユーザーを抱える「Facebook」や5億人のユーザーを持つ「Twitter」など、巨大なソーシャルグラフを持つサービスが、日々その存在感を増しています。日でも、グリーやモバゲーなどがそれぞれソーシャルゲームプラットフォームを公開し、国内に一気に巨大なソーシャルゲーム市場を作り上げました。最近では、ユーザー数が5000万人を突破し、プラット

    「OAuth」の基本動作を知る
  • git commitをやり直しする&取り消しする(「get commit --amend」と「git reset」) - hogehoge foobar Blog Style Beta

    git commitを実行あとでコミットをやり直したり、コミット自体を取り消す方法です。 直前にしたコミットをやり直す(git commit --amend) 直前にしたコミットをやり直す場合、「git commit --amend」を使用します。 例えば、直前のコミットログが以下のような状態だったとします。 実は直前のコミットに含めるべきであった「hoge.txt」が含まれていませんでした。 コミットログ(git commit --amend 実行前) $ git log commit cca638b48b4c8be7ad5432f7882497534b04e2b4 Author: mrgoofy <hogehoge@example.com> Date: Wed Sep 8 23:03:57 2010 +0900 2nd Commit.-> New Add File : bar.txtこ

    git commitをやり直しする&取り消しする(「get commit --amend」と「git reset」) - hogehoge foobar Blog Style Beta
    ysomtok
    ysomtok 2014/04/29
    歴史の改変。複数のコミットを1コミットに。
  • grepをよく使うプログラマはどう考えても乗り換えるべき新しいgrepコマンド「ack」:phpspot開発日誌

    Beyond grep: ack 2.04, a source code search tool for programmers grepをよく使うプログラマはどう考えても乗り換えるべき新しいgrepコマンド「ack」。 サーバに入ってコードを書いている人はかならず使うgrepですが、grepよりも高速に検索でき、git,svn等のソースコード以外のソースはgrepしないで検索できるツールらしいです。 Perlで書かれていて、Perlの強力な正規表現が使え、ハイライトしてくれます。ソースツリーの下で「ack 検索ワード」で検索するだけというシンプルさもいいです WEBサービスを書いているとhtmlphp等色々なソースをいじりますが、ファイルの検索対象も選べるため、便利です。 ack --php <検索ワード> でphpのソースのみを対象とし、ack --nophp <検索ワード>でphp

  • PHP: The Right Way

    ようこそ 時代遅れの情報がウェブ上にあふれている。そんな情報を見たPHP初心者は戸惑ってしまうだろう。そして、まずい手法やまずいコードが広まってしまう。 そんなのはもうやめよう。PHP: The Right Way は気軽に読めるクイックリファレンスだ。PHPの一般的なコーディング規約、 ウェブ上のよくできたチュートリアルへのリンク、そして現時点でのベストプラクティスだと執筆者が考えていることをまとめた。 大事なのは、 PHPを使うための正式なお作法など存在しない ってこと。 このサイトの狙いは、はじめて PHP を使うことになった開発者に、いろんなトピックを紹介すること。 経験豊富なプロの人にとっても、これまで深く考えることなく使ってきた内容について、新鮮な見方を伝えられるだろう。 このサイトは、決して「どのツールを使えばいいのか」を教えるものじゃない。 いくつかの選択肢を示して、それぞ

    ysomtok
    ysomtok 2014/04/29
  • 5vor9 | Axel Schlueter

    Hello, my name is Axel Schlueter. I develop easy to use and beautiful software for the Mac, mobile devices and the web.

    ysomtok
    ysomtok 2014/04/29
    xcodeをvimライクに。有料。
  • 【AWS】非エンジニアのための初めてのAmazon Web Services 資料をまとめてみた | DevelopersIO

    はじめに こんにちは植木和樹です。2013年2月2日は私がAWSに初めて触れた日で、日が1周年となります。JAWS-UG北陸(金沢)の勉強会でアマゾンデータサービスジャパンの堀内さんによるハンズオン(実際に画面を操作しての体験会)が開かれ、そこでEC2やRDSを触れたのが初となります。 実際にはその3ヶ月ほど前から、ネットに流れてくるAWS関係のニュースをみたり、自分のクレジットカードを使ってアカウントを作ったりはしていたのですが、マネージメントコンソールを用いた操作をちゃんとしたのがこの日が初めてだったわけです。 さてAWSを始めた方の多くは、まずEC2にApache+PHPを起動しRDSでMySQLを用意して・・・というエンジニア向けなところから入ってくる場合が多いようです。上記の通り私もその口で、それまで10年程やっていたインフラ(サーバー)エンジニアの延長としてAWSと関わり始め

    【AWS】非エンジニアのための初めてのAmazon Web Services 資料をまとめてみた | DevelopersIO
    ysomtok
    ysomtok 2014/04/27
    AWSを使うときはコレを読もう
  • Twitterをもっと便利に検索する12の演算子とその使い方 - F.Ko-Jiの「一秒後は未来」

    Google 検索に様々な検索演算子(オペレーター)があるように、Twitter検索にも多くの演算子が用意されています。 あまり知られていないかもしれないので、ここで簡単に紹介しておきます。これらのオペレーターを使いこなすことで、もっと効率的に世界の今を知ることができるかもしれません。(これらはTwitterのサイドバーにある検索窓からでも利用できるものです。) 1. OR 検索 2個以上の単語のうちいずれかを含むつぶやきを検索したいときは「OR」を使います。たとえば「インフルエンザ」または「タミフル」を含むつぶやきを検索したいときは、 インフルエンザ OR タミフル と検索します。 2. フレーズ検索 ウェブの検索エンジンと同じように、2個以上の単語をダブルクォーテーションで括ると、それらの単語が語順を含めそのフレーズのまま現れるつぶやきを検索できます。たとえば "listening t

    Twitterをもっと便利に検索する12の演算子とその使い方 - F.Ko-Jiの「一秒後は未来」
  • Railsのfixtureをvimプラグイン「Align」ですっきり整形 - komagataのブログ

    fixtureってymlよりcsvの方が書きやすいと思いません? 項目の並びが気にわなかったり、複雑な置換したり・・・。 っていうのは前に書きましたが、編集にはいちいちsamba経由でOpenOffice Calcを使っていて、なんだか不便に感じてました。 CUIのスプレッドシートアプリ無いのかな? → vimCSV整形するプラグインあればいいんじゃないのか? ということでCSVに限らず、高機能なテキスト整形ツールのAlignというプラグインを知りました。 インストール・設定: http://www.vim.org/scripts/script.php?script_id=294 からスクリプトをダウンロード、解凍する。 解凍したAlign.vbavimで開く。 :so % 日語で丁度良く整形されるように.vimrcに追記。 let g:Align_xstrlen = 3 CSV

    ysomtok
    ysomtok 2014/04/22
    csv をカンマで整形できたりする
  • 「老後に必要な貯蓄額」を簡単に計算する方法 | ライフハッカー・ジャパン

    老後を快適に暮らすためには、仕事を引退するまでにどれくらい貯蓄しておく必要があるのでしょうか? この金額を求めようとして、複雑で面倒な計算をしてしまう人がいるかもしれません。確かに、厳密な数字を出そうとすれば大変ですが、大まかな見積もりならそれほど苦労しなくても計算できます。今回は、この見積もりをサッと計算する方法をご紹介しましょう。 年金制度や資産運用について詳しいScott Holsopple氏は、「US News Money」で、この計算を次のように説明しています。 まずは、現在の所得額を調べます。これは、現在の年収の税引き前の金額のことです(なぜ税引き前かというと、大半の人は忘れているかもしれませんが、実は退職後も税金を支払わなければならないからです!)。次にその数字を20倍します。 これは、あなたが退職後におよそ20年間生きると仮定した計算です。それは、あなたの目標通りかもしれな

    「老後に必要な貯蓄額」を簡単に計算する方法 | ライフハッカー・ジャパン
  • IM Free

    Design, build and publish for free, plus get unlimited hosting, with unlimited bandwidth. We think everyone should be able to build their own site, and we’re proud to provide a fair website maker. Creating a website with IM Creator is simple, fast, and intuitive. Anyone can create a website in a matter of minutes, using our industry-leading editor. No coding necessary!

    IM Free
  • 【個人メモ】CentOS環境に登録するyumリポジトリ - Qiita

    yumパッケージ 身の回りの環境がCentOSばっかりだ。 が、CentOSをインストールしただけの環境では インストールできるパッケージは古い物ばかりだ。 できれば新しいものを使いたい。 少しだが、登録しとくと良さそうなリポジトリをまとめておく。 対象のCentOSのバージョンは6.5。 epel fedoraプロダクトが提供しているRHEL向けの ディストリビューションに適用できるパッケージ。 ansibleやdockerを入れたい場合には必須 リポジトリ登録方法 > yum localinstall http://dl.fedoraproject.org/pub/epel/6/x86_64/epel-release-6-8.noarch.rpm

    【個人メモ】CentOS環境に登録するyumリポジトリ - Qiita
  • CSS3 Image Styles - Web Designer Wall

    When applying CSS3 inset box-shadow or border-radius directly to the image element, the browser doesn’t render the CSS style perfectly. However, if the image is applied as background-image, you can add any style to it and have it rendered properly. Darcy Clarke and I put a quick tutorial together on how to use jQuery to make perfect rounded corner images dynamically. Today I’m going to revisit the

    CSS3 Image Styles - Web Designer Wall
  • 海外の消費者心理学の専門家が語る、WEBサービスをユーザーの習慣の一部にする方法[前編] - VASILY GROWTH HACK BLOG

    リクルートが、シリコンバレーおよび東京から著名なグロースの専門家を招聘し、連続のミートアップ・シリーズを開催するリクルートGrowth Hacker Month。 先日、最終回となる第4回のMeetupが開かれ、スピーカーとしてNir Eyal氏が登壇してくれた。 Nir Eyal氏は、グロースハックの必須分野である消費者行動心理学の専門家。 グロースのアドバイスを行うコンサルティングファームを創業し、500 Startupsを始め、スタートアップや大企業の支援を行っている。 先日、自身の理論をまとめた「hooked」という書籍を出版し、既にすさまじい勢いで売れている。 (近く、日語版も出るそう) 引用:リクルートGrowth Hacker Month 第4回 彼の提唱する「hooked」というモデルは、ユーザーがついそのプロダクトを使ってしまうという"習慣"を形成するための理論であり、

    海外の消費者心理学の専門家が語る、WEBサービスをユーザーの習慣の一部にする方法[前編] - VASILY GROWTH HACK BLOG
  • Takazudolog - 地獄のvideo/audio要素

    video/audioにハマりまくったメモ。作ってたのは、Flashでやってたような、複数の動画ファイルを、途中の選択肢によって色々変えながら見せるというようなインタラクティブムービーみたいなの。なので、ハードにvideoを使いまくるという意味で、普通に一動画を見せるという用途よりももっと色々する必要があったわけだけれども、そうでない場合でも、videoが色々厄介であるということは知っておく必要があると思う。 とりあえず、videoやaudioを使いたい人は、以下の2ページを熟読せよ。 プラグインは要らない!音声/動画対応したHTML5 - audio/video要素 | Think IT Video - Dive Into HTML5 videoのイベントは HTML5 Video を眺めてるとなんとなく分かる。 audioライブラリ試してうまくいったやつはこれ。 SoundJS vi

    Takazudolog - 地獄のvideo/audio要素
  • AlfredからDashで検索する - Qiita

    DashはURLスキーム(dash)を持っているのでそれを利用して下の画像のように設定する。 また、特定の docset だけを対象にした検索設定を作成したい場合は、{query} の前に android: のように docset の識別子を挿入することで実現出来る。 android: の部分は、 Dash の設定画面の Docsets タブで確認可能。 Register as a new user and use Qiita more conveniently You get articles that match your needsYou can efficiently read back useful informationYou can use dark themeWhat you can do with signing up

    AlfredからDashで検索する - Qiita
  • 【永久保存版】初心者 ~ 上級者向け Gitをより理解するために厳選したサイトやスライドをまとめてみた | nanapi [ナナピ]

    はじめに この記事は、筆者が自分自身のためにまとめたものですが。以下のような方にもとってもオススメできるのでぜひご覧ください。 これからGitを覚えたい方(まだ簡単に追いつけます!) Git使っているけど実はよくわかっていない方(怖がらず裏を理解すれば意外と簡単でシンプルなんですよ!) 日常的にGit使いこなしているけど、いざというときググってしまう方も理解を深めるのに役立つと思います。(怖くない!Git!!) Gitの基礎・振返り向けサイト Git家! サイトデザインもかなり洗礼!ここらへんにも人気具合が伺えます。 git-scm.com ドキュメント(日語)も豊富で素晴らしい。 Git - Book The entire Pro Git book, written by Scott Chacon and published by Apress, is available here

  • フロントエンド開発者向けのAlfred Workflow - アインシュタインの電話番号

    1ヶ月前に、Web開発者にオススメなAlfred用のWorkflowをまとめたGitHubリポジトリが2,000 starsを超える人気を博していて、その中に自作のFont Awesome Workflowも選ばれていて、それをきっかけに開発者向けのWorkflowが盛り上がっていることを知った。[^1] [^1]: このリポジトリは更新が遅く、各Workflow作者の最新バージョンを反映していない問題があったため、Font Awesome Workflowではこちらから削除依頼を出してリストから消してもらいました。そのため現在は掲載されていません。 つい最近だと、Googleエンジニアで著名なAddy Osmaniがプレゼンで紹介していたり、フロントエンド向け情報サイトとして有名なSmashing Magazineが特集記事にしていた。 Automating Front-end Wor

    フロントエンド開発者向けのAlfred Workflow - アインシュタインの電話番号
  • Components · Bootstrap

    Alerts Provide contextual feedback messages for typical user actions with the handful of available and flexible alert messages. Examples Alerts are available for any length of text, as well as an optional dismiss button. For proper styling, use one of the eight required contextual classes (e.g., .alert-success). For inline dismissal, use the alerts jQuery plugin.

    Components · Bootstrap